#E2E83B Color
#E2E83B is rgb(226, 232, 59) in RGB, hsl(62, 79%, 57%) in HSL, and about cmyk(3%, 0%, 75%, 9%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pear (#D1E231),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.34.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#E2E83B Channel Values
How #E2E83B bre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 226 · G 232 · B 59 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 62° · S 79% · L 57%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 62° · S 75% · V 91%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 3% · M 0% · Y 75% · K 9%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.33:1 vs white · 15.84: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#E2E83B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#E2E83B?
#E2E83B is a mid-tone yellow — rgb(226, 232, 59) in RGB and hsl(62, 79%, 57%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pear (#D1E231),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.34.
What is the RGB value of #E2E83B?
#E2E83B is rgb(226, 232, 59) — red 226, green 232, and blue 59 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#E2E83B?
#E2E83B converts to approximately cmyk(3%, 0%, 75%, 9%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#E2E83B be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#E2E83B scores 1.33:1 against white and 15.84: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#E2E83B as a CSS color keyword?
No. #E2E83B is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is yellow (#FFFF00) at a CIE76 distance of 18.77, which is visibly different.
